Warning Signs You Need Structural Repair After Water Damage

Ignoring war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your home can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a musty smell that won’t go away,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your flooring,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ains on ceilings and walls can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any peeling paint or wallpaper,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Discoloration or Warping of Wood

Discoloration or warping of wood can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your wood,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your home can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any unusual sounds or creaks,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Structural Repair After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No Small leaks are usually easy to fix and don’t need specialized equipment.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Water damage from a burst pipe can be extensive and need specialized equipment to dry and repair.
Water damage from a natural disaster No Yes Water damage from a natural disaster can be extensive and need specialized equipment to dry and repair.
Water damage in a crawl space or attic No Yes Water damage in crawl spaces or attics can be difficult to access and need specialized equipment to dry and repair.
Water damage from a flooded basement No Yes Water damage from a flooded basement can be extensive and need specialized equipment to dry and repair.
Water damage from a roof leak No Yes Water damage from a roof leak can be extensive and need specialized equipment to dry and repair.

Structural Repair After Water Damage Cost In Katy, TX

The cost of structural repair after water dam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Katy, TX. Our team provides free estimates to help you understand the cost of the repairs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Inspection $200 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Structural Repair and Replacement $2,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age and type of materials need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$200 – $500 Severity of damage and type of repairs needed

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to help you understand the cost of the repairs.

Q: How do I prevent water damage in my home?

A: To prevent water damage in your home, it’s essential to regularly inspect your home for signs of water damage, such as musty odors, warped or buckled flooring, and water stains on ceilings and walls. You should also ensure that your home is properly ventilated and that your roof and gutters are in good condition.
